Pavers Installation in Boston, MA
Pavers installation services involve laying durable, attractive paving materials to enhance outdoor spaces such as driveways, walkways, patios, and garden paths. These projects typically require careful planning to select the right type of pavers, which can include concrete, brick, or stone, and proper installation techniques to ensure longevity and stability. Homeowners often want to understand the scope of work, the variety of paving options available, and how the finished surface will complement their property’s aesthetic and functionality.
Before requesting pavers installation, property owners should consider factors like the intended use of the paved area, drainage requirements, and the existing landscape. It’s also helpful to understand the maintenance needs of different materials and the overall cost implications. Clear communication about project size, design preferences, and any site-specific challenges can help ensure the installation meets expectations and provides a durable, appealing outdoor feature.

Pavers Installation Questions
What types of surfaces can be paved? Paving services can be used for dri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or entertainment areas to enhance functionality and appearance.
What materials are commonly used for p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ability levels.
Are pavers suitable for uneven or sloped surfaces? Yes, pavers can be installed on uneven or sloped surfaces with proper base preparation to ensure stability and longevity.
What projects are pavers typically used for? Pavers are often used for creating durable walkways, decorative patios, driveway accents, and outdoor seating areas.
